Tasting Notes: White Peach, Orange Sherbet, Chrysanthemum
This is a very tasty Colombian Gesha from Leonardo Henao's farm in Santa Barbara "El Jardín". Leonardo and his brother Felipe won the 2020 Colombia cup of excellence with their Chiroso! It's not particularly surprising to see how they managed that when you taste how meticulously processed this coffee is. It captures some of the enhanced fruit flavors that a well executed Kenya-style washing process brings without the funk that is often found in other Colombian coffees with extra fermentation steps.
In the aroma we find notable amounts of white peach followed by zesty citrus like blood orange and bergamot, along with herbal leaning florals like chrysanthemum and violet. On the taste, the peach hits up front, quickly turns into a creamy sweet citrus note like orange sherbet, and ends with an interesting herbal chrysanthemum tea finish.
We do find a little bit of fade flavor in this green so it will have a discounted price on what was otherwise a moderately pricey Gesha. It tastes too good to let go to waste and will have a huge enjoyment to cost ratio for those not too sensitive to the fade flavor.
